Riemann surfaces is a subject that combines the topology of structures with complex analysis: a riemann surface is a surface endowed with a notion of holomorphic function. this turns out to be an extremely rich idea; it’s closely connected to complex analysis but also to algebraic geometry. The goal of this seminar is to develop a mathematical understanding of integrable systems. we will focus on the interplay between algebraic and geometric aspects and on the way discuss di erent ideas and tools from lie groups and algebras, symplectic geometry, and complex geometry. 6) an application of riemann surfaces to integrable systems, more precisely finding sections of an eigenvector bundle over a riemann surface, which is known as the "algebraic reconstruction" method in integrable systems, and we mention how it is related to baker akhiezer functions and tau functions.
